Complete converter revamp in Eisenhüttenstadt
LONDON, UNITED KINGDOM – ArcelorMittal Eisenhüttenstadt and Primetals Technologies have successfully installed a new converter suspension system for the 255-ton LD converter (BOF) No.2 in Eisenhüttenstadt, Germany. The entire system was replaced and commissioned within just 50 days, ensuring the converter, which turns hot metal into liquid steel, can continue to operate safely and sustainably.
Strong Collaboration
Primetals Technologies conducted an engineering study to determine the optimal solution for ArcelorMittal Eisenhüttenstadt, resulting in a highly customized and cost-effective approach that maximized the continued use of existing converter equipment. Primetals Technologies was also responsible for equipment manufacturing and supply, as well as providing advisory services during construction, commissioning, and startup.

High Quality Flat Steel
ArcelorMittal Eisenhüttenstadt supplies high-quality flat steel products and services to a variety of industries, including automotive, household appliances, and construction. The plant has an annual capacity of up to 2.5 million tons of crude steel and employs 2,700 people, making it the largest industrial hub in East Brandenburg.
